The Toronto Maple Leafs best puck mover from the back end is Jake Gardiner, though Morgan Rielly is catching up.
Despite his puck skills, Gardiner has never been able to eclipse the 31 point mark which is surprising given how well he moves the puck.
Part of that has to do with the atrocious rosters the Toronto Maple Leafs have iced during his time in blue and white. Well, those days are almost over and this year Gardiner will be moving the puck up to the most talented group of forwards he’s been teammates with at the NHL level.
